About the program

The Oregon Convention Center is committed to making event spaces more accessible for historically underrepresented communities. Informed by community feedback and guided by OCC’s Racial Equity Action Plan and Metro’s Strategic Plan to Advance Racial Equity, Diversity, and Inclusion (SPAREDI), the Space to Grow Fund helps local organizers bring mission-driven events to life.

This program is more than just financial support—it’s an investment in events that directly benefit and uplift our region. We prioritize events that:

  • Are led by or actively supported by communities of color or other underrepresented groups
  • Strengthen cultural and community assets
  • Provide opportunities for cultural expression
  • Increase community impact, collaboration, and growth

Through this initiative, we aim to:

  • Expand the size, scope, and reach of regional cultural events
  • Support local opportunities to convene, collaborate, and celebrate
  • Drive community investment through education, leadership development, and fundraising
  • Provide tools, resources, and assistance to ensure event success

If you’re planning an event that creates meaningful community impact, the Space to Grow Fund is here to help make that vision a reality.

Who can apply?

  • Organizations located in and servicing Clackamas, Multnomah, and/or Washington County.  
  • Organizations demonstrating a commitment to diversity, equity, inclusion and accessibility through their programming, staffing and operations. 
  • 501(c)(3) non-profit  
  • Individuals or groups supporting community-led initiatives without nonprofit status 
  • Firm certified by the Oregon Certification Office of Business Inclusion and Diversity (COBID): Minority Business Enterprise (MBE), Women Business Enterprise (WBE), Veteran Business Enterprise (VBE), and Emerging Small Business (ESB).  
  • Events attracting over 200 attendees will be prioritized. 
  • An organization may submit multiple applications but is only eligible for one grant per cycle. 

Requirements

  • Event must occur between April 1, 2025, through June 30, 2026, at the OCC.  
  • Events contracted within the past 5 years are ineligible (March 3, 2025 and before)
  • In-kind funding for OCC facility rental and services only, no cash awards. 
  • OCC will make every effort to accommodate preferred event date(s) and spaces. If your event has a firm date or preferred space, please email [email protected] to check availability. 
  • Ability to secure a certificate of insurance at a minimum $2 million comprehensive general liability insurance covering the event period through a company such as Gather Guard. (Estimated cost, $200) 
  • Campaign and proselytizing events are ineligible. 
  • Events attracting over 200 attendees will be prioritized in the evaluation process. 
  • Post-event reporting on impact
  • Campaign and proselytizing activities are not eligible.

Contracting and agreements 

  • Application of awarded funds will be applied to the client’s invoice at the close of the event. Award recipients enter into a License Agreement with the OCC. Recipients must also comply with all applicable requirements and laws related to event operations, safety and security, food handling, and other obligations outlined in these agreements.
  • OCC requires event hosts to secure a certificate of insurance at a minimum $2 million comprehensive general liability insurance covering the event period through a company such as Gather Guard (Estimated cost, $200).

Application instructions

Online application 

  • Apply through our online portal located here. 
  • All applicants will be required to create a user account. Detailed instructions and video tutorials available. 
  • Completed applications must be submitted through the online portal by March 3, 2025, at 5:00 pm PST for first review or by the final deadline on August 15, 2025, at 5:00 pm PDT.
